freerm

Beta testing

freerm ("free RM") is my own back office — bookings, invoicing, a lightweight CRM, and cash-flow forecasting for running a freelance AV business without paying for a bloated SaaS package. It started as a Google Sheets CRM and has been rebuilt on Firebase so it actually holds up under daily use. Right now it's built for how I run my own business — it isn't open to other users yet, but opening it up for other freelancers is on the roadmap.

CRU

In development

CRU started life as RS Audio — a simple venues-and-engineers directory on my old site. It's grown into a full crew booking, rostering, and invoicing platform with real accounts for admins, crew, and clients: booking requests turn into gig offers, crew claim shifts, and invoicing/payouts happen without a spreadsheet in sight. Built with Next.js and Supabase, it's the tool I wanted to exist for coordinating AV crews on real events.
